Vivo X300 series launch date leaked, could feature dual 200MP Zeiss cameras

The Vivo X300 series, which is expected to comprise the standard Vivo X300 and Vivo X300 Pro, could launch next month in China. It will succeed the Vivo X200 series and may debut as the world’s first phones powered by the upcoming MediaTek Dimensity 9500 chipset.

Vivo has started to tease its upcoming flagship X300 series, ahead of its impending launch in the coming weeks. Moreover, as we near their official announcement in China, rumours about the series are surfacing on the internet, with the most recent one coming from a known Chinese tipster. He has also revealed that the upcoming lineup could follow a similar launch timeline to last year’s X200 series.

Vivo X300 series: Expected launch date, specifications

Earlier this week, the Vivo Product Manager, Han Boxiaoa, revealed some key details of the Vivo X300 Pro. Now, in a post on Weibo, tipster Digital Chat Station has revealed that the first handset to be powered by a MediaTek Dimensity 9500 chipset is tentatively scheduled to launch in China on October 13. The comments on the post suggest that it could be Vivo X200 Pro. In another post, the tipster also shared that the Vivo X300 model will feature a 50MP Sony LYT602 periscope telephoto camera.

Previous reports have also claimed that the standard Vivo X300 will succeed the Vivo X200 Pro Mini this year, and will launch alongside the Vivo X300 Pro. Further, the rear camera setup of the Vivo X300 will likely feature a 200MP Samsung HPB main camera accompanied by a 50MP periscope telephoto camera. On the other hand, the X300 Pro is tipped to have a 200MP main camera and a 200MP Samsung HPB periscope telephoto camera. Both devices are also expected to feature a Samsung JN5 ultra-wide camera, and these phones will come with Zeiss tuning.

Coming to its performance, the Vivo Product Manager also confirmed that the X300 Pro scored 40,11,932 points on the AnTuTu benchmarking platform. The device will also feature a dual-channel UFS 4.1 four-lane onboard storage. The X300 series may pack a battery capacity of more than 6,000 mAh, and both phones are expected to support 90W wired charging.
